An outstanding MYP mathematics book guide points to “Super Simple Math” from DK’s MYP collection, which presents mathematical concepts in highly visual, accessible formats ideal for middle years learners.

Key Features of Super Simple Math:

  • Visual Learning Approach: Uses clear diagrams and illustrations to demystify complex mathematical concepts.

  • Comprehensive Coverage: Spans the MYP mathematics curriculum with age-appropriate explanations.

  • Supplementary Resource: Designed to support and enhance schools’ existing MYP curriculum, not replace it .

Related Mathematics Resources:

  • “What’s the Point of Math?” – Another DK title that explores the real-world applications and relevance of mathematical concepts.

  • “How to Be a Math Genius” – Encourages mathematical thinking and problem-solving skills.

These books are part of a curated collection matched to core MYP disciplines, with a free downloadable guide suggesting how to incorporate links to ATLs, learner profile attributes, and subject-specific assessment criteria.
